Robotron PC-1715
Type: PC-1715 <<< >>> ^^^
Manufacturer: VEB Robotron
Technology: uP U880 (Z80)
Year: 1985
Price:
Before the introduction of the 16Bit microprocessors in the GDR, there
was the CP/M operating system, which was called DDR SCP there, widely
spread for the small commercial data processing. The PC 1715 has a
very high quality and has the typical 70s lacquer style.
It is interessesting that although normally the EVP(retailing price) was
imprinted, this was not the case for any computer: This is perhaps
comprehensible for the PC 1715, because it probably did not belong to
the consumer goods. The EVP isn't even imprinted on a box of the LC 80
and not even on the one of the SC-2 chess computer.
